May 9–10, 2026: The College of Fisheries at Mindanao State University-Sulu spearheaded a two-day training workshop on Aquasilviculture and Eco-Tourism in Angilan, Omar, Sulu. This initiative is part of an ongoing project collaboration between MAFAR-Sulu and MSU-Sulu.

The team conducted technical sessions aimed at providing participants with essential knowledge regarding the principles, techniques, and management practices of aquasilviculture and eco-tourism. The participants included community beneficiaries and Eco-Tourism Guards who are members and officers of the Angilan Culture Association.

On the first day, two Resource Persons shared their technical expertise. Ma’am Fardia J. Abduhsad, RFP (OIC-Chief of the Fisheries Division at MAFAR-Sulu), discussed the "Principles and Practices of Mangrove Aquasilviculture," while Ma’am Sulirma Sabtula, RFP (OIC-Chief of the Fishery Resource Management Section at MAFAR-Sulu), presented on the "Effective Management of Eco-Tourism Destinations."

On the second day, additional experts shared their insights. Mr. Al-nasrif Kissae and Ms. Khadiza Imlan—both faculty members of the MSU-Sulu College of Fisheries holding Master of Science degrees in Aquaculture—led discussions on "Marine Biodiversity Conservation and Protected Area Delineation" and "Community Stewardship and Environmental Protection Laws."

In terms of share in value, the major destinations of Philippine fish and fishery export products were: USA (27.06%), Japan (12.64%), China (10.57%), Netherlands (6.20%), Germany (6.17%), Spain (5.23%), United Kingdom (3.68%), Hong Kong (3.16%), Taiwan (2.46%), and Republic of Korea (2.17%). All other countries have a cumulative share of 20.64% (PFP, 2021).
